在线咨询
专属客服在线解答,提供专业解决方案
声网 AI 助手
您的专属 AI 伙伴,开启全新搜索体验

直播SDK和短视频直播SDK应该如何选择?

2025-09-17

直播SDK和短视频直播SDK应该如何选择?

在当今这个内容为王的时代,视频已经成为我们生活中不可或缺的一部分。无论是轻松搞笑的短视频,还是激动人心的赛事直播,视频内容以前所未有的速度和广度渗透到各个角落。对于许多希望在自己平台或应用中加入视频功能的企业和开发者来说,一个核心问题随之而来:面对市面上琳琅满目的视频技术方案,究竟应该选择直播SDK还是短视频直播SDK呢?这不仅仅是一个技术选型的问题,更关乎产品定位、用户体验和商业模式的深层考量。选择正确的技术方案,就像为一艘航船选择了正确的引擎,将直接决定它能否在数字内容的海洋中乘风破浪,顺利抵达成功的彼岸。

核心功能大不同

首先,我们需要明确一点,虽然直播SDK和短视频直播SDK都处理视频,但它们的核心设计理念和功能侧重点却大相径庭。直播SDK,顾名思义,其核心是实现“实时”音视频互动。它就像一个虚拟的电视台,致力于将现场发生的一切,以最低的延迟、最流畅的画面,实时传递给成千上万的观众。它的技术核心在于处理实时音视频流的采集、编码、传输、解码和播放,并确保整个链路的稳定性和低延迟。例如,声网提供的直播SDK,就特别强调其在全球范围内的网络传输能力,通过智能路由算法,确保即便是跨国直播,也能将延迟控制在毫秒级别,这对于需要强实时互动的场景,如在线教育、电商直播、体育赛事等至关重要。

与此相对,短视频直播SDK虽然也包含了“直播”二字,但它的功能重心更多地倾向于“短视频”的创作与社交分享。它不仅提供基础的直播推流和播放能力,更集成了一整套强大的视频处理和编辑工具。这套工具箱里通常包含了美颜滤镜、动态贴纸、分段录制、变速拍摄、背景音乐添加、视频拼接剪辑等五花八门的功能。它的目标是让用户能够轻松创作出富有创意和趣味性的短视频内容,并通过平台的社交机制进行传播。因此,短视频直播SDK在技术上除了要保障直播的基础体验外,还需要在客户端(即手机APP端)的图形图像处理、AI算法应用以及素材管理等方面投入大量的研发精力。

应用场景的抉择

功能上的差异直接导致了两者在应用场景上的巨大不同。选择哪种SDK,很大程度上取决于你的产品想要为用户提供什么样的核心体验。

直播SDK的应用场景通常围绕着“实时互动”和“事件同步”展开。想象一下,一场重要的产品发布会,或者一场激动人心的足球比赛,观众最在意的就是能够第一时间、无延迟地看到现场实况。在这些场景下,哪怕是一两秒的延迟,都可能极大地影响用户体验。因此,新闻媒体、体育平台、大型企业发布会等,都是直播SDK的典型用武之地。此外,像在线课堂、视频会议、一对一的视频客服这类场景,不仅要求低延迟,还要求高质量的双向或多向音视频互动,这也正是专业直播SDK,如声网产品所擅长的领域。

而短视频直播SDK则更多地服务于泛娱乐和社交领域。它的场景核心是“内容创作”和“社区氛围”。例如,一个生活分享类的APP,希望用户能随时随地记录和分享自己的生活点滴,并与朋友们互动。这时,短视频直播SDK提供的丰富拍摄和编辑功能就显得尤为重要。用户可以通过它轻松制作出Vlog、才艺展示、搞笑段子等内容,并通过点赞、评论、分享等方式形成社交裂变。这类应用的核心不在于追求极致的低延迟,而在于降低内容创作的门槛,激发用户的创作热情,构建一个活跃的内容社区。

一张图看懂如何选

为了更直观地展示两者的区别,我们可以通过一个表格来进行对比:

直播SDK和短视频直播SDK应该如何选择?

直播SDK和短视频直播SDK应该如何选择?

特性维度 直播SDK 短视频直播SDK
核心目标 实时、同步、低延迟的事件传递与互动 降低创作门槛,鼓励用户生产和分享创意视频内容
技术重点 全球网络传输优化、低延迟保障、高并发处理、多终端兼容 客户端的视频编辑、AI美颜特效、素材管理、社交分享接口
延迟要求 极高(通常要求毫秒级或1-3秒内) 相对宽松(直播功能作为辅助,延迟要求不高)
典型功能 超低延迟直播、连麦PK、实时字幕、在线白板 美颜滤镜、动态贴纸、分段录制、音乐库、视频剪辑
适合场景 电商带货、在线教育、体育赛事、视频会议、企业直播 社交分享平台、Vlog社区、才艺展示应用、生活记录工具

技术与成本的考量

除了功能和场景,技术实现和长期成本也是决策过程中不可忽视的重要因素。从技术角度看,集成直播SDK,特别是像声网这样提供全球化服务的SDK,开发者需要更多地关注服务端的架构设计。如何应对高并发的观众请求?如何设计合理的转码和分发策略以适应不同网络状况的用户?这些都是需要重点解决的问题。声网通过其覆盖全球的数据中心和智能路由网络,极大地简化了开发者的工作,但开发者仍需对自己的业务流量有清晰的预估和规划。

短视频直播SDK的技术挑战则更多地集中在客户端。要在形形色色的手机设备上实现流畅、稳定且效果出众的视频拍摄和编辑功能,是一项非常复杂的工作。这涉及到对不同手机硬件编解码能力的适配、对GPU渲染管线的深度优化,以及对各种AI算法(如人脸识别、手势识别)的高效集成。这不仅对客户端开发团队的技术能力要求很高,而且后期的维护和更新成本也不容小觑,因为需要不断跟进新的手机型号和操作系统版本。

在成本方面,两种SDK的计费模式通常也不同。直播SDK的费用往往与“流量”和“时长”紧密挂钩。也就是说,观看直播的人越多,直播的时间越长,你需要支付的费用就越高。这种模式非常直观,但也意味着如果你的平台用户量激增,相应的成本也会快速上涨。而短视频直播SDK,其核心的视频编辑和特效功能通常是以功能模块授权(License)的方式收费,这部分费用相对固定。其附带的直播和点播功能,则可能同样采用按流量或时长计费的方式。因此,在做预算时,你需要综合考虑固定授权费和可变的流量费用,并结合自己的商业模式来评估长期的投入产出比。

总结与未来展望

总而言之,选择直播SDK还是短视频直播SDK,并非一个简单的“哪个更好”的问题,而是一个“哪个更适合”的问题。这个决策过程需要你回归到产品的初心,深入思考以下几个问题:

  • 我的核心用户价值是什么?是提供实时的信息和互动,还是鼓励用户创作和分享?
  • 我的商业模式是什么?是通过实时互动(如打赏、带货)变现,还是通过社区活跃度和广告变现?
  • 我的技术团队擅长什么?是更偏向于后端高并发架构,还是更精通于客户端的复杂功能实现?

明确了这些问题的答案,你的选择自然会水落石出。对于那些目标明确,希望快速切入电商直播、在线教育等强互动领域的平台,一个稳定、低延迟的专业直播SDK(如声网)无疑是最佳选择。而对于希望构建一个以UGC(用户生成内容)为核心的娱乐社交平台的开发者来说,功能丰富的短视频直播SDK则更能满足其需求。

展望未来,我们也能看到一个明显的趋势,那就是两者的界限正在逐渐变得模糊,融合成为一种新的可能性。用户既希望能在观看直播时享受超低延迟的互动,也希望能在直播结束后,方便地将精彩片段剪辑成短视频进行二次传播。这就对技术服务商提出了更高的要求。未来的视频SDK,或许不再是单一功能的集合,而是一个高度模块化、可自由组合的“视频能力平台”。开发者可以像搭积木一样,根据自己的业务需求,灵活选择直播、短视频、实时合唱、虚拟形象等不同的功能模块,快速构建出独一无二的视频应用。在这个过程中,像声网这样拥有深厚技术积累和全球化服务能力的企业,将扮演越来越重要的角色,为整个视频行业的创新提供坚实的技术底座。

直播SDK和短视频直播SDK应该如何选择?